On April 9, the Office of Online and Adult Learning will be hosting the seventh annual Adult Learner of the Year (ALOTY) and the Online Learner of the Year (OLOTY) awards ceremony. OAL is calling on the WSU community to help find an adult learner and an online learner at WSU deserving of the title.
Students nominated for this award should exemplify the criteria outlined:
- Grade point average (GPA) of 3.0 or higher (extenuating circumstances can be reviewed)
- Academic advancement: Noteworthy improvement in academic performance and/or high levels of positive engagement within a classroom setting or substantial contributions to the overall learning process
- Personal triumphs: Overcoming personal hurdles and demonstrating resilience
- Shocker pride: Active participation in their personal community or within their classes showcasing a commitment to making a positive difference
